Vale S.A., together with its auxiliaries, engages in the research, production, and sale of iron ore and pellets, nickel, fertilizer, copper, coal, manganese, ferroalloys, cobalt, platinum group metals, and precious metals in Brazil and internationally.

Silver Wheaton Corp. operates as a precious metals streaming company worldwide. The company has 18 long-term purchase agreements and 1 early deposit long-term purchase agreement associated with silver and gold regarding27 various mining assets.

Potash Corporation of Saskatchewan Inc., together with its auxiliaries, produces and sells fertilizers and related industrial and feed products worldwide. The company operates in three segments: Potash, Nitrogen, and Phosphate.
